Secure Identity Research Group
Class Definition
@interface Rectangle : NSObject {! float x; float y;! float h; float w; BOOL awesome;}@property float x;@property float y;@property BOOL awesome;
- (void)setWidth:(float)width height:(float)height;+ (Rectangle)newStandardRectangle;@end
16
Secure Identity Research Group
Class Implementation
@implementation Rectangle
@synthesize x; @synthesize y;@synthesize awesome;
// Initalizer- (id)init { // Assign self to value returned by super's // designated initializer // Designated initializer for NSObject is init if (self = [super init]) {! ! x = 0; y = 0;! ! h = 0; w = 0;! ! awesome = YES; } return self;}
17
Secure Identity Research Group
Class Implementation (continued)
// Methods
- (void)setWidth:(float)width height:(float)height{! h = height;! w = width;}
+ (Rectangle)newStandardRectangle(){! id sr = [[Rectangle alloc] init];! [sr setWidth: 1 height: 1];! sr.x = 0; sr.y = 0; sr.awesome = NO; [sr autorelease];! return sr;}
@end
